unreal-engine4 - 宏内的变量
问题描述
如何在宏中创建变量?我已经创建了一个包含一些宏的宏库,现在我试图弄清楚如何在宏的生命周期内创建一个存在于宏中的局部变量。也许有办法将这些数据存储在其他地方?
解决方案
在编辑宏时,使用Details 面板的 Inputs 集合创建所需类型的虚拟变量。
不要选中 By-Ref 复选框。
调用宏时不要连接它。
像使用任何其他变量一样使用该变量。
如果您不使用延迟或时间线等潜在函数,请改用函数。
每当我需要代码重用时,我都会创建函数库。
推荐阅读
- python - 为什么`multiprocessing.Process()`会在windows上创建一个中间进程?
- ios - 如何修复仅落在IOS上的cordova导航栏?
- java - Retrofit 2.0:获取响应代码 200 但未获取所需数据
- ios - 从应用程序内部更改应用程序语言后更改 TabBar 项
- sql - 如何仅为最大记录提供标签
- ios - 从 Socket 接收批量数据时应用程序冻结。iOS | Socket.io | RealmSwift
- reactjs - 是否可以将门户与 React 15 和 react-select 一起使用?
- angularjs - 角度前端中的状态池
- sympy - 获得同情以简化包含分段函数的无限和
- xml - Logstash XML 文件解析 - Conf Reload 时尴尬的事件拆分问题